Output 3c33d57cbac9b7a6f8579e5841091ab03cf5579037a3b63a893554495152772e:0

value
307582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6946e2b12f52d4868e675e7bc0e4edf7d85f90 OP_EQUAL
address
3DDRBUsfensfnhvENpqJ1xpsQTztmACJw7
transaction
3c33d57cbac9b7a6f8579e5841091ab03cf5579037a3b63a893554495152772e
spent
true